IMPACT OF INDUSTRIALIZATION ON NON-INDUSTRIALIZED COUNTRIES
New patterns of global trade and production developed: a global economy developed because industrialists sought raw materials new markets
Need for raw materials & food supply for growing population in urban centers = growth of export economies
Specializing in mass producing single natural resources
